Transaction 5fc8e19b5972521949fa357abbeb799a1137391ce657ddf45108b828efab739e

2 Input
2 Outputs
  • 5fc8e19b5972521949fa357abbeb799a1137391ce657ddf45108b828efab739e:0
  • value  169850000
    address  1FfAWvsRhMRD2i9Qe64qfio514FcYEEe3C
  • 5fc8e19b5972521949fa357abbeb799a1137391ce657ddf45108b828efab739e:1
  • value  84111000
    address  12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A